Of Few Days

Man that is born of a woman is of few days, and full of trouble. Job 14:1 KJV

The older I become, the more I realize how precious the gift of life truly is.

It is truly a blessing to wake up each day. It’s a blessing when a baby is born healthy. It’s a blessing when we go to bed with our stomachs full. It’s a blessing to have protection from the elements.

So many blessings, great and small.

When we realize the gift that we are blessed with, and how fleeting time is… We stop holding on to unnecessary unforgiveness and bitterness. Forgiveness comes so much easier, so much quicker.

When we realize how quickly life and time can pass us by, we understand Jesus’ words in Matthew 16:26 KJV For what is a man profited, if he shall gain the whole world, and lose his own soul? or what shall a man give in exchange for his soul?

We wouldn’t spend our whole lives working, attaining worthless, worldly gain… Only to discover that at the end of our lives: we can’t take it with us and our lives amounted to so much more than our possessions.

I’m only 38, as I write this, and I thank God that I learned from the wisdom of elders whom I chose to surround myself with, these biblical truths.

Our days are short. We will have troubles. But we must be quick to forgive. Quick to love. Slow to anger. Slow to speak. And understand the value of quality time. Understand the value of relationships over possessions.
